BIM Coordinator – Data Centre & Aviation Sectors Overview We are seeking a technically proficient BIM Coordinator to support the delivery of large-scale Data Centre and Aviation projects. Working alongside a creative, collaborative, and motivated team, the ideal candidate will demonstrate a passion for digital construction, a proactive approach to project delivery, and a desire to continuously evolve and innovate within the built environment. This is a pivotal role, contributing to the delivery of complex technical projects across all design stages – from concept through to construction and handover. You’ll play a key part in shaping and refining BIM workflows, mentoring team members, and championing the use of digital tools to ensure design excellence, coordination, and efficiency. Key Responsibilities Lead BIM project coordination activities from kick-off, including model setup, execution planning, and team guidance Monitor and advise on model health and clash detection throughout the design and delivery process Collaborate with multi-disciplinary teams, including consultants and contractors, to ensure successful delivery in a shared model environment Develop, manage, and maintain BIM content, families, templates, and sector-specific workflows tailored to Data Centre and Aviation projects Provide on-the-job Revit support, technical training, and mentoring to internal staff across multiple offices Support the integration of Revit with associated tools, including visualisation, computational design, reality capture, and construction technology platforms Contribute to R&D within practice technology – identifying, testing, and implementing innovative workflows Support sustainable design initiatives through energy modelling or computational design processes, where applicable Document and share best practices across projects and teams to support continuous improvement in BIM delivery Key Requirements Strong communication skills – able to explain complex digital processes clearly and confidently Must have extensive experience using Autodesk Revit and related Autodesk tools on large, technically complex projects (essential) Familiarity with BIM360 / Autodesk Construction Cloud (preferred) Working knowledge of ISO 19650 standards (desirable) Autodesk Certified Professional in Revit is an advantage Exposure to tools such as Navisworks, Rhino, Grasshopper, Python, Enscape, Twinmotion, and other visualisation or computational tools is a plus Prior experience delivering projects in either the Data Centre or Aviation sector is highly desirable A self-starter with strong organisational skills, attention to detail, and a collaborative mindset Benefits Our client believe that investing in our people leads to better outcomes for everyone.
